Plan for the Evening
- Welcome - Practicing Praying for One Another
- Ask for 3 volunteers to pray for one of the following topics:
- One another and what we may be facing this week - Consider what we face on a day to day basis and how others may also face the same; pray for them as you would want someone to pray for your (loving your neighbor as yourself)
- Our church community - Praise for God’s Work thus far and for God to continue to keep us being faithful
- Our world - what headlines or news concern you about our world? Pray for God’s grace and mercy to pour out for the people of this world and for our leaders
- Bible Study Leader closes in prayer
- This week, we have joint service and so we are not yet back in Colossians - but we will resume what we learned last week by taking a look at certain types of Psalms
- Introduction to the different types of Psalms
- Practice praying one Psalm together (you can choose one or pray Psalm 23)
- Break up into groups of 3-4 (if not enough people come, then we can just stay as one group or break up into groups of 1-2).
- In your groups, consider the different types of Psalms available and read through a couple (you can do this together or individually)
- Choose one Psalm you would like to practice praying (if it is a longer Psalm, then you can choose to pray just a small section of the Psalm - you don’t always have to pray the entire Psalm every time)
- Share why the Psalm spoke to you
- Close out with a prayer
